{"categories":[{"label":"Electronic Design Automation (EDA)","url":"https://skillfed.io/packages/category/scientific-engineering-electronic-design-automation-eda"}],"enrichment":{"capability":"Converts between SystemRDL register descriptions and IP-XACT XML format, enabling import and export workflows for hardware register modeling.","skillfed_tags":["hardware-design","register-automation","eda-tools"],"use_cases":["Export a SystemRDL register model to IP-XACT XML for consumption by commercial EDA tools","Import an IP-XACT register definition from a third-party IP vendor into a SystemRDL-based design flow","Automate register documentation generation by converting between formats in a CI/CD pipeline","Validate register specifications by round-tripping through both SystemRDL and IP-XACT representations","Integrate legacy IP-XACT designs into a modern SystemRDL-based register automation framework"],"what_it_does":"PeakRDL-ipxact bridges the SystemRDL register description language and the IP-XACT XML standard, two widely used formats in hardware design automation. It provides bidirectional conversion: exporting compiled SystemRDL register models into IP-XACT XML for integration with other EDA tools, and importing existing IP-XACT files back into the systemrdl-compiler namespace for further processing.\n\nThe package is part of the PeakRDL toolchain ecosystem and depends solely on systemrdl-compiler. It targets hardware engineers and EDA tool developers who work with register specifications and need to exchange designs between SystemRDL workflows and IP-XACT-based tools. The package is marked Production/Stable and supports Python 3.6 through 3.12, though it has not been updated since its latest release on 2024-10-15.","worth_installing":"Yes, if you work with both SystemRDL and IP-XACT in hardware design.
